Nebraska Extends Offers to Promising Mississippi Defensive Lineman

Jan 23, 2025 at 8:37 PM

The Nebraska football team has recently ventured into Mississippi, extending offers to two talented prospects from the same high school program. Among them is Sam LeJeune, a 6-foot-4, 285-pound defensive lineman from Poplarville High School. LeJeune, currently unranked but holding offers from Florida State, Mississippi State, and Nebraska, expressed his gratitude for the Huskers' interest. He noted that the offer means a lot to him, especially considering Nebraska's strong defensive line and promising future. The offer came from new outside linebackers coach Phil Simpson, who encouraged LeJeune to continue working hard and prove why he was offered. Although LeJeune hasn't planned any visits yet, he is eager to see the Nebraska stadium in person.
